Patterns of Global Genetic Diversity of Streptococcus pneumoniae Inferred Based on Archived Multilocus Sequence Typing Data

Abstract

Streptococcus pneumoniae is the major cause of invasive pneumococcal disease (IPD). Since 1998, multilocus sequence typing (MLST) has been used for identifying the genotypes of strains of S. pneumoniae and helped reveal a diversity of local and regional epidemiological patterns for IPD, resulting in an archived MLST dataset of over 74,000 isolates.
